The Corrosion Inhibitor market within the Automotive Parts industry is a specialized sector that focuses on the prevention of corrosion in metal components. Corrosion inhibitors are used to protect metal surfaces from oxidation and other forms of deterioration. These products are typically applied to the surface of the metal part and can be used in a variety of automotive applications, such as engine components, exhaust systems, and brake systems. Corrosion inhibitors are designed to provide long-term protection against corrosion and can be used in both new and existing vehicles.
The Corrosion Inhibitor market is highly competitive, with a variety of manufacturers offering a range of products. Companies in the market include BASF, Dow Corning, Henkel, PPG Industries, and AkzoNobel. These companies offer a range of corrosion inhibitors, including organic and inorganic compounds, as well as specialty products for specific applications. Show Less Read more
